Dragon Ball Project: Multi Becomes Gekishin Squadra Ahead of Network Test
Bandai Namco updated its Dragon Ball Project: Multi 4v4 free-to-play MOBA, giving it the name Dragon Ball: Gekishin Squadra, revealing platforms, and confirming a June 2025 Network Test. Starting on June 12, 2025, Switch, PS4, PS5, PC, and mobile players will be able to take part in that open beta. The official site and Steam page both updated to reflect the reveals. The Dragon Ball: Gekishin Squadra Network Test will start at 2am ET on June 12, 2025, but Bandai Namco didn’t note when the client for it will appear on storefronts. It did let folks know that they may need to look up a version with “Exhibition Match” in the title to find it. We don’t know every character who will be playable, but the trailer showed an array of familiar faces like Goku, Vegeta, Piccolo, Future Trunks, Krillin, Majin Buu (Good), Android 18 and Zamasu. It also looks like the Super Saiyan versions of characters are different than standard ones. Folks who take part will get to play for four days until 1:59am ET June 16, 2025, and cross-play and cross-save will be supported.
